Senior .net Developer Resume
PROFESSIONAL EXPERIENCE:
Senior .Net Developer
Confidential
Responsibilities:
- Paradigm and Solvera solutions were the prime vendors on building a IRIS system for the Ministry of Energy and Resources since it started on 2013, The system allows the Oil and Gas industry a streamlined/ automated process to enter information vs. previous manual / paper - based system. Khaled was responsible for the development part of IRIS EOR self-service, which is expand the use of IRIS, providing industry with a portal to a self-serve prepopulated EOR return that will ensure a consistent calculation methodology, providing accurate and timely royalty/tax rate data and expand the user of notification and integration with the IRIS billing application and the main legacy system.
- .Net Development for IRIS EOR Project for Solvera / the ministry of Energy and Resources.
- Practical experience on client sites using the technologies mention below and proficiency with the
- Ability to speak to the inner workings of the technologies with an understanding of the constructs and how they should be applied.
- Ability to deliver and productive.
- Building Unit test using C# language..
- Design and Create Sql Server Databases and generate the required scripts.
- Test and debugging, data validation and test case scenarios.
- Searching internet for new technologies and new systems to develop internal work.
Environment: /Tools: TFS (Visual Studio Team Foundation Server), C# using a custom built development environment/ framework (XDE),ASP.net, MVC, WFC, SQL Server,SQL Runner, IIS, Javascript, Ajax, Json, Razor, JQuery, CSS, Activebatch
Senior Software Engineer
Confidential
Responsibilities:
- Developed highly secured reliable APIs to provies the Mobile App with its functionality.
- Restructured Visual Studio project for efficiencies and better version control and code reuse.
- Distributed risk management allowed immediate trading in pre-approved and "safe" situations.
- Created web testing scripts to simulate the user website experience.
- Facilitated sessions with the business analyst and development teams.
- Configured the system to support secure e-payment methods.
- Provided support during transition to production.
- Assisted the Advance Support team when necessary.
Environment: /Tools: C#,.Net Wep API, IdentityServer4, IIS, Json,Javascript,Jquery,Sql Server 2016,Web API, JIRA, Visual Studio Code,Visual Studio 2013, GIT, Amazon AWS.
Senior Software Engineer
Confidential
Responsibilities:
- Maintained a technique to convert instructional videos into small-size raw data Json files, then developed another server-side tool to collect the raw data files and generate high quality (.avi) video.
- Developed a javascript project to generate from the previous raw data file a video over a SVG object using D3.js library.
- Coordinated activities between the development and infrastructure teams.
- Provided support during transition to production.
- Acted as front-line support during initial week after go-live.
Environment: /Tools: C#,.Net Wep API, IdentityServer4, IIS, Json,D3.js,Javascript, Sql Server 2016,Web API, JIRA, Visual Studio 2013, TFS, Amazon AWS.
Senior Software Engineer
Confidential
Responsibilities:
- Collected requirements from the clients and set the project scope and implementation plan.
- Responsible for day-to-day system operation, including orders adjustments, client statements and back office reports.
- Implemented a full integration with the Payroll system to perform the salary deduction and get the employee information.
- Assessed various software options to produce a comparison of functionality, development costs, risks and benefits.
- Presented recommendations to the business analyst and lead architect.
- Coordinated activities between the development and infrastructure teams.
- Designed and created highly efficient SQL server database to support the application with minimum response time.
Environment: /Tools: C#, Angular JS, SQL Server 2012, Crystal Reports, IIS, XML,JIRA,TFS.
Senior Software Engineer
Confidential
Responsibilities:
- Interfaced with 3rd party applications and services such as Attendance devices, utilized custom in-house and off-the-shelf controls.
- Conducted analysis reports about user requirements, new task requirements and impact of new task on the internal work flow.
- Designed modules by dividing the user requirements into sub modules and set time frames for task completion.
- Assigned sub-modules to software developers and started programming of modules.
- Held software demonstrations for business analyst and product manager.
- Provided front line support to system users.
- Wrote test plans and release documentation.
- Instrumental in promoting better design practices and scalable enterprise processes.
- Analyzed server logs to debug production issues and to supply metrics to management.
Environment: /Tools: C#, ASP.NET MVC, Angular JS, SQL Server 2012, IIS, XML,JIRA,TFS, Amazon AWS.
Senior Software Engineer
Confidential
Responsibilities:
- Integrated with third party tools and APIs in the website including PayPal and 2checkout to enable purchasing process.
- Provided reliable APIs to support the company's Mobile App “Kotob” with functions of searching and download from the portal database.
- Analysis, design and implementation of data migration scripts for differing schemas.
- Rapidly developed server access legacy data for newly developed .NET interface to system.
- Provided leadership, as required, to a team of programmer/analysts by resolving technical issues, establishing design, coding, and testing priorities, assigning design, coding, and testing tasks to team members, and working with management to resolve non-technical issues.
- Participated in daily scrums. Provided technical advice on bugs and enhancements.
- Developed complex SQL scripts for retrieving and converting existing data and for populating new database structure.
Environment: /Tools: C#, ASP.NET MVC, Javascript, JQuery,Web APIs, SQL Server 2012, IIS, XML, JIRA,TFS, Amazon AWS.
Senior Software Developer
Confidential
Responsibilities:
- Upgraded the web portal from Asp.Net Web Forms to MVC 3
- Played a leading role in implementing security, optimized and streamlined web presence for a logistics company.
- Functional design and development of new application features.
- Converted business needs into technical specifications and systems design.
- Developed reliable APIs to support the project Mobile App.
- Performed code reviews and unit testing.
- Developed complex SQL scripts for retrieving and converting existing data and for populating new database structure
Environment: /Tools: Asp.Net WebForms, Asp.net MVC, Javascript,JQuery, Sql Server 2008, Web API, JIRA,Visual Studio 2010, TFS, Amazon AWS.
Senior Asp.net Developer
Confidential
Responsibilities:
- Resolved customer issues working with the Support team. This included logging into their onsite installation.
- Designed and developed SQL Database and supported it with quick maintenance.
- Participated in user requirements gathering, project planning, design, implementation and testing.
- Developed support software for all products, including deployment, upgrades, customer support and maintenance.
- Designed and wrote Functional Specifications and Design (FSD) for application development
Environment: /Tools: Asp.Net WebForms, Javascript,JQuery, Sql Server 2008,Visual Studio 2003, Source Safe.
Asp.net Developer
Confidential
Responsibilities:
- Invented a novel, high-efficiency solution for concurrency control improving throughput and reliability of system.
- Coordinated with business product manager and business analysts to review detailed requirements in order to convert those into the technical details needed by the development team.
- Designed complex MS-SQL queries, stored procedures, and triggers including data migration and data warehousing
- Primarily coded all projects, starting from design to implementation, using full System Development Life Cycle (SDLC) and best practices methodologies.
- Managed and led two offshore developers.
Environment: /Tools: Asp.Net WebForms, Javascript, JQuery, Sql Server 2008,Visual Studio 2003, Source Safe.
Software Developer
Confidential
Responsibilities:
- Helped debug and resolve critical software issues with rapid turnaround.
- Quality Assurance testing of software modifications and fixes.
- Resolved internal and external defects.
- Performed problem management and analysis reducing a backlog of system trouble reports.
- Introduced and championed use of improved development cycles and testing.
- Provided 24/7 support for daily overnight processing.
Environment: /Tools: Asp.Net WebForms, Javascript, Sql Server 2005,Visual Studio 2003, Source Safe.
Software Developer
Confidential
Responsibilities:
- Tested, debugged and maintained databases.
- Quality Assurance testing of software modifications and fixes.
- Developed, amended and constructed software codes using Microsoft visual studio.Net as a programming tool with different databases (Oracle and MS SQL).
- Created Software reports, user Manuals, documentations and process diagrams using UML tools.
- Introduced and championed use of improved development cycles and testing.
- Worked directly with end-users to maximize efficiencies and user-friendliness.
Environment: /Tools: Asp.Net WebForms, Javascript, Sql Server 2005,Visual Studio 2003, Source Safe.
